The Need for Speed

Let's face it - nobody enjoys waiting for a website to load. Research has shown that a mere one-second delay can lead to a staggering 7% drop in conversions, resulting in lost revenue and dissatisfied users. Moreover, slow-loading websites often find themselves at a disadvantage in search engine rankings. In a highly competitive online marketplace, every second matters when it comes to gaining an edge over competitors.

Tips for Optimizing Site Speed for Marijuana Dispensaries

Ensuring fast site speed is crucial for any successful online business, and marijuana dispensaries are no exception. A slow-loading website not only frustrates users but also negatively impacts SEO rankings. Here are some effective strategies to optimize site speed for marijuana dispensaries:

  1. Choose a Reliable Hosting Provider: Begin your site speed optimization journey by selecting a reputable hosting provider. A reliable provider will have high uptime, fast server response times, and advanced caching mechanisms. This ensures your website loads quickly and consistently, regardless of traffic spikes.

  2. Compress and Optimize Images: High-quality product images are essential for cannabis dispensaries, but large image files can significantly slow down your website. Compressing and optimizing images reduces their file size without sacrificing visual quality. Tools like TinyPNG or ImageOptim can help with this process.

  3. Minify and Combine Files: Reduce the number of HTTP requests made by your website by minifying and combining files. Minification refers to removing unnecessary characters and white spaces from CSS, JavaScript, and HTML files. Combining multiple scripts or stylesheets into a single file reduces the number of required requests, improving load times.

  4. Enable Browser Caching: Browser caching allows visitors' browsers to store certain elements of your website, such as images, stylesheets, or scripts, locally. This means that when users return to your site, these elements don't need to be reloaded, resulting in faster load times. Implementing browser caching can be done through web server configurations or using caching plugins.

  5. Utilize Content Delivery Networks (CDNs): CDNs duplicate your website's files across multiple servers worldwide. When a user accesses your site, the CDN delivers the content from the server nearest to their location, reducing latency. By distributing the load, CDNs effectively speed up your website for any visitor, regardless of geographical distance.

  6. Implement Lazy Loading: Lazy loading is especially useful when your marijuana dispensary website contains a vast number of images or videos. This technique delays the loading of images or videos that are below the fold until the user scrolls down, reducing the initial page load time.

  7. Regularly Optimize and Update Plugins: If you use plugins or themes on your website, keeping them updated is crucial for optimal site speed. Developers frequently release updates with bug fixes and performance improvements. Outdated plugins can slow down your site or lead to compatibility issues.

By implementing these site speed optimization tips, marijuana dispensaries can provide visitors with a fast and seamless browsing experience. A faster website leads to improved user engagement, higher conversions, and better SEO rankings, ultimately driving the success of your online dispensary.

The Benefits of Site Speed Optimization

Site speed optimization is a critical aspect of creating a successful website. It involves implementing various techniques to reduce page load times and improve overall performance. When you focus on optimizing your website's speed, you can reap several benefits that positively impact both user experience and search engine optimization.

Enhanced User Experience:

The first and most obvious advantage of site speed optimization is providing an optimal user experience. In today's digital world, users expect websites to load quickly and efficiently. A slow-loading website can frustrate visitors, leading them to abandon your site and seek information elsewhere. By optimizing your site speed, you can ensure that users have a seamless and swift browsing experience, which encourages them to stay on your site, browse more pages, and convert into customers.

Improved Search Engine Rankings:

Apart from user experience, site speed optimization also plays a vital role in search engine rankings. Search engines, like Google, consider page speed as one of the ranking factors. Faster-loading websites often rank higher in search engine result pages. When your website loads quickly, search engines can crawl and index your content more effectively, resulting in better visibility for your pages. By prioritizing site speed optimization, you can increase your chances of ranking higher and attracting more organic traffic to your site.

Higher Conversion Rates:

A faster website not only improves user experience but also boosts conversion rates. Studies have shown that even a one-second delay in page load time can lead to a significant drop in conversions. On the other hand, faster-loading websites tend to have higher conversion rates. When visitors can easily access your content, products, or services without any delays, they are more likely to take action and convert into leads or customers. By optimizing your site speed, you can create a frictionless experience that encourages visitors to complete desired actions, leading to increased sales and revenue.

Better Mobile Experience:

With the increasing use of mobile devices, having a mobile-responsive and speedy website is crucial. Slow-loading websites can be particularly frustrating on mobile devices, where internet speeds may vary and bandwidth is limited. By optimizing your site speed for mobile, you can ensure that your website loads quickly, providing a smooth and seamless experience for mobile users. This, in turn, improves user satisfaction, encourages engagement, and boosts your mobile search rankings.
